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ll send our team to assess the damage and identify the source. We’ll take detailed notes and photos to create a comprehensive plan for restoration.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action and preventing further damage.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our team will use specialized equipment to extract as much water as possible from your property. We’ll use truck-mounted extractors and wet vacuums to ensure that every inch of your property is dry.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water is extracted, we’ll use specialized drying equipment to dry your property. We’ll also set up d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ture and prevent mold growth.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your property to remove any remaining bacteria, viruses, or other contaminants.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ning products and follow strict protocols to ensure your property is safe and healthy.

Step 5: Repair and Reconstruction

Finally, we’ll repair and reconstruct any damaged areas, including walls, floors, and ceilings. We’ll work with you to ensure that the repairs are done to your satisfaction and meet local building codes.

Warning Signs You Need Condo Water Damage Restoration

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ong musty odors can show high levels of moisture in your property. Don’t ignore these smells, they can be a sign of mold growth or water damage.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a leaky roof or burst pipe. Don’t delay, address these stains quickly to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Floors

Warped or buckled floors can show water damage or high levels of moisture.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to costly repairs down the line.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or high levels of moisture. Don’t delay, address these issues quickly to prevent further damage.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ks can show a problem with your plumbing or HVAC system. Don’t ignore these signs, address them quickly to prevent further damage.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age can be a sign of a serious issue. Don’t delay, address these issues qu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Condo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water stain on ceiling Yes No You can likely fix this with a DIY repair kit.
Burst pipe in wall No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to fix.
Standing water in hallway No Yes This needs immediate attention to prevent mold growth and further damage.
Water damage to multiple rooms No Yes This needs a comprehensive plan to restore your entire property.
Unknown source of water damage No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to identify the source and fix the problem.
Water damage to electrical or HVAC systems No Yes This needs specialized expertise to ensure your systems are safe and functional.

Condo Water Damage Restoration Cost in Tolleson, AZ

The cost of condo water damage restoration in Tolleson, AZ can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Type of cleaning products used, size of affected area
Repair and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of repairs needed
Assessment and Planning $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
Equipment Rental $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ed

Q: How can I prevent water damage in the future?

A: Regular maintenance, such as inspecting your plumbing and HVAC systems, can help prevent water damage. You can also consider installing flood sensors or water alarms to alert you to potential problems.
